Tere Liye offers a nuanced look at the dynamics of friendship within a band, mixed with the complexities of love and rivalry. The atmosphere feels intimate, almost like you're part of their rehearsals, with music weaving through the narrative. The pacing can be a bit uneven at times, but it captures those moments where tension builds—especially with Ritu's protectiveness over Aditya. Performances are heartfelt, particularly in how they portray young ambitions and insecurities. There's something quite relatable about their struggles, and the way music serves as both a bonding agent and a source of conflict is distinctive. It's an interesting blend of drama and family themes, reminding us of the bittersweet nature of pursuing one’s dreams.
